开源项目推荐:搭建你的个人飞机追踪站——Raspberry Pi OpenSky Network ADS-B基站
在技术爱好者的世界里,探索天空从不局限于仰望星辰。通过开源力量,你可以变身为地面飞行情报员。今天,我们聚焦于一个令人兴奋的项目:“Raspberry Pi ADS-B Base Station for OpenSky Network”,它将带你进入航空数据的世界。
项目介绍
这个开源指南引领你动手构建基于Raspberry Pi的低成本飞机自动相关监视系统(ADS-B)基站,让你能够接收并解码方圆200至300公里内飞行器的信号。借助这一设备,不仅可实时监控周边空域,还能与OpenSky Network这样的平台共享数据,供飞行爱好者和专业人士使用。
技术剖析
项目的核心是Raspberry Pi搭配廉价的RTL-SDR接收器,利用开源软件dump1090
进行信号解码。这涉及Linux环境下的软件编译安装、网络配置乃至简单的电子装配。特别的是,dump1090
以其实时性和高效性闻名,能够在无需昂贵专业设备的情况下,实现民用级别的飞机位置追踪。
应用场景广泛
家庭航空迷:
对于航空爱好者而言,拥有这样一个基站意味着能在家中实时查看附近航班,成为私人版的“空中交通管制”。
教育工具:
在教育领域,该项目可以作为STEM(科学、技术、工程和数学)学习的实践案例,激发学生对电子学和编程的兴趣。
研究与数据分析:
对于研究人员,收集到的数据可用于研究航线模式、飞行效率或空中交通管理优化等。
项目亮点
- 易部署:即使是新手也能跟随详细步骤搭建基站。
- 低成本:仅需一套Raspberry Pi套件和一些标准无线电组件。
- 社区支持:加入OpenSky Network社区,获取全球飞行数据分享与交流的机会。
- 教育价值:提供了一个完美的DIY项目来学习嵌入式系统、无线电通讯和数据分析。
- 技术整合:结合了物联网(IoT)、无线电接收、以及Web服务部署的技术应用,拓宽技术视野。
结语
通过搭建自己的ADS-B基站,你不仅成为了连接天空与地面信息的桥梁,更是在实践中学习了一门综合技术课程。无论你是航空发烧友、技术开发者还是教育者,这个项目都值得尝试。让我们一起利用开源的力量,让科技之翼更加展翅高飞,探索无垠的蓝天。